Benefits of Bunk Beds with Trundle
Choosing a bunk bed with a trundle provides several advantages, especially in homes where space is at a premium. A few of the key benefits include:
Space-Saving Design: Bunk beds are created vertically, permitting two beds to inhabit the very same floor footprint as a single bed. The trundle can be hidden underneath the lower bunk, making it an outstanding alternative for smaller bed rooms.
Versatility: Bunk beds with trundles can be used in various configurations. The trundle can be taken out for sleepovers, or it can serve as extra storage space for toys, blankets, or books when not in usage.
Cost-efficient: Purchasing a bunk bed with a trundle can be more cost-effective than buying separate beds for brother or sisters or visitors.
Enjoyable Factor: Bunk beds are typically viewed as a fun alternative to conventional beds, making them extremely appealing to children. The raised bed can stimulate a sense of experience and create a relaxing nook for playtime.
Increased Sleep Space: A trundle provides an extra sleeping option without jeopardizing on space, especially advantageous for larger families or frequent visitors.
Kinds Of Bunk Beds with Trundle
When looking for kids's bunk beds with trundles in the UK, you will find a variety of designs and configurations. Below are some popular types:
1. Standard Bunk Bed with Trundle
- This is the classic setup where one bed is stacked above the other, and a trundle is located beneath the lower bunk. It typically is available in wooden or metal styles.
2. Loft Bed with Trundle
- A loft bed is raised greater than a standard bunk bed, enabling space underneath that can typically be used for play, storage, or perhaps a small desk. A trundle can still be integrated below the loft.
3. L-Shaped Bunk Bed with Trundle
- An L-shaped configuration offers more floor space and can fit comfortably into a corner. The trundle is typically positioned under one of the lower bunks.
4. Convertible Bunk Bed
- These beds can be transformed into 2 different twin beds. If a trundle is included, it can also be utilized with either of the two beds.
5. Triple Bunk Bed with Trundle
- Ideal for larger families, this option consists of space for 3 beds, along with a trundle for additional sleeping lodgings.
Choosing the Right Bunk Bed with Trundle
When selecting the perfect bunk bed with trundle for a child's room, numerous aspects must be thought about to ensure that it satisfies the needs of your household while preserving security and convenience.
Considerations:
Safety Standards: Ensure that the bunk bed abide by UK safety policies. Try to find beds with guardrails and a sturdy ladder.
Product Quality: Opt for long lasting materials, such as solid wood or premium metal, to make sure longevity.
Size: Measure the room to make sure that the bunk bed fits conveniently without crowding the space. Also, think about the height of the ceiling to make sure that there's sufficient headroom for the upper bunk.
Mattress Size: Confirm the mattress sizes needed for both the upper and lower bunks and the trundle. Standard sizes in the UK consist of single (3 feet by 6 feet 3 inches) and small double (4 feet by 6 feet 3 inches).
Style: Choose a style that complements the space's existing decor. Whether opting for a classic wooden frame or a contemporary metal bed, the design plays an essential function in improving the room's aesthetic appeals.
Storage Options: Some bunk beds include built-in drawers or shelving systems, using extra storage for valuables.
Relieve of Use: Consider how simple it is to take out the trundle and make beds, especially if the bunk bed will be utilized regularly.
